I ASKED A MACHINE SHOP TO MAKE ME A DRIVESHAFT, HERES WHAT I WANTED....
DOUBLE CV ON ONE END THAT BOLTS ON TO THE TRANSFERCASE, SLIP IN THE MIDDLE AND SINGLE U JOINT ON THE OTHER THAT BOLTS TO THE YOLK, 1350 JOINTS FOR ALL AND THEY WANTED OVER 600 BUCKS TO MAKE IT.
DOES THAT SOUND RIGHT? I WAS GOING TO BRING THEM ALL THE PIECES ALL THEY HAD TO DO IS WELD EVERYTHING TOGETHER AND BALANCE IT........ I THINK I ALMOST GOT RIPED OFF
 

That would definatly be a rip-off!!

I got my front drive line for my Chevy made about a month ago. All brand new tubing, joints, ground the stops off, double CV on one end, single u-joint on the other, slip in middle and 1 ton joints for $375. And, that included balancing, painting, and everything else to make it a direct bolt-on.

The guy might not have wanted to do it either. $600 is a crazy price even if it included parts. It's not that the driveshaft would be worth $600, but he might have to pull off of another job where he COULD be making $600. I wouldn't assume its a cut and dry case of him trying to be a crook, but I'd find another shop to make my shaft!
 
I agree with Junkpile. He'd probably have to retool to do that job. So there would have been a lot of expense in it for him. I used to get the CV joints in my driveshafts on the old Toy done at a semi-truck driveline shop in Wichita....pretty cheap, but I don't remember how much.
